I honestly don't know what to think?The Thunder has thrown me off balance by jumping from 23 wins to 50 in one season.Trying to be objective about it I say the Thunder will be somewhere bewteen 45-52 wins.I guess I figure OKC is more likely to slide back a little then move up.My reasoning ?First they deoend on the Big Three(Durant,Green,Westbrook) so much and they were remarkably healthy last year.Secondly the six supporting regulars all played their parts so well,nobody thinking they were bigger than they are.Can Kristic,Collison,Sephalosha,Maynor,Harden,Ibaka all perform as well as they did last year?Will anyone develop an ego problem in this group ? How does Aldrich fit in? Does he disrupt the Supporting Six rotation? Finally there is coaching,Brooks has done a marvelous job BUT he has 1 2/3 years experience,does he continue upward,level off,or drop off?

I hoestly don't know how to answer that because of Brooks' short coaching career so my best guess is we still in the 50 win neighborhood (+ or - 4games).
